bigeminy

/baɪˈdʒɛmɪni/
noun
  1. A heart rhythm in which every normal heartbeat is followed by a premature beat, creating a pattern of pairs.
    • During the stress test, the monitor showed episodes of bigeminy.
    • The cardiologist explained that bigeminy is often harmless but can cause palpitations.
    • Patients with bigeminy may feel a fluttering sensation in their chest.
